Picked up a cool Tube Anemone from All About Fish last weekend. I'm a little worried about it's long term survival, but so far it seems to be doing well. My sand bed is only a couple inches deep so I got a piece of 2" PVC about 4" in length and shoved it into the sand bed, placed the nem's tube in it, and filled in the sand around it so it has a thicker bed of sand to stay burrowed. It's kinda hard to do though so the top section of his tube is still exposed. Hopefully that's ok or maybe he'll manage to bury himself a little more.
